Article image
Lucas Ramos
Lucas Ramos09/09/2025 23:24
Compartilhe

Automação de RH com n8n e Inteligência Artificial

    📌 Introdução

    Os processos de Recursos Humanos são historicamente manuais, lentos e sujeitos a falhas. Com a combinação de n8n (plataforma low-code de automação) e modelos de Inteligência Artificial (GPT + Gemini), foi possível construir um ecossistema completo que vai da triagem de currículos à validação documental, reduzindo tempo e erros, além de proporcionar escalabilidade.

    🔎 Arquitetura Geral

    image

    O sistema foi dividido em cinco agentes especializados, cada um responsável por uma etapa crítica do processo de contratação.

    1️⃣ Agente Currículo

    Objetivo: Receber currículos via Outlook, extrair dados e salvar em Supabase.

    Tecnologias:

    • Outlook Trigger
    • Extract PDF
    • GPT (com JSON Schema)
    • Supabase

    Exemplo de Prompt Utilizado:

    "Você é o recrutador em uma agência... 
    Retorne 5 coisas:
    1. Porcentagem de correspondência do currículo com a vaga;
    2. Resumo curto com decisão final;
    3. Por que é adequado;
    4. Por que não é adequado;
    5. Nome completo do candidato."
    

    Exemplo de Saída Estruturada:

    {
    "Nome_Completo": "Maria Silva",
    "Senioridade": "Pleno",
    "areas_de_experiencia": ["Administração", "Finanças"],
    "anos_experiencia": 8,
    "pontos_fortes": ["Organização", "Domínio de Excel"],
    "pontos_fracos": ["Pouca experiência internacional"]
    }
    

    2️⃣ Agente Solicitação de Currículos

    Objetivo: Permitir que o RH solicite perfis pelo Microsoft Teams e receba uma lista filtrada.

    Exemplo de Prompt Utilizado:

    "Você é um super agente de triagem de currículos...
    Retorne: 
    1. Nome do candidato; 
    2. Resumo breve; 
    3. Arquivo (ID_Microsoft e ID_PDF)."
    

    Saída:

    • Nome: João Pereira
    • Resumo: Analista de Dados com 5 anos de experiência em BI.
    • IDs: ID_Microsoft=XYZ, ID_PDF=12345

    3️⃣ Agente Geração de Contrato

    Objetivo: Criar automaticamente contratos personalizados no Google Docs e enviar por Outlook.

    Exemplo de Substituição Automática:

    {
    "action": "replaceAll",
    "text": "[NOME-FUNCIONARIO]",
    "replaceText": "={{ $('Edit Fields2').item.json.NOME }}"
    }
    

    O documento é baixado, convertido em PDF e enviado para assinatura.

    4️⃣ Agente Verificação de Contratos

    Objetivo: Validar contratos assinados comparando com o modelo padrão.

    Exemplo de Prompt Jurídico:

    "Você é um analista jurídico... 
    Compare os contratos e retorne:
    - Porcentagem de conformidade,
    - Pontos em conformidade,
    - Divergências encontradas."
    

    5️⃣ Agente Verificação de Documentos

    Objetivo: Validar CNH, RG e outros documentos em imagem usando IA multimodal.

    Exemplo de Saída da IA:

    {
    "tipo_documento": "CNH",
    "legivel": true,
    "completo": true,
    "nome_completo": "Lucas Gabriel Rocha Ramos",
    "cpf": "666.666.666-66",
    "validade": "2033-08-30"
    }
    

    🔧 Stack Tecnológica

    • n8n: backbone de orquestração.
    • IA (GPT + Gemini): análise de texto e imagens.
    • Supabase: banco de dados relacional.
    • Google Docs & Drive: automação de contratos e pastas.
    • Microsoft Outlook & Teams: canais de comunicação.
    • JavaScript (Code Node): transformações e lógicas customizadas.

    ✅ Resultados Obtidos

    • Redução de até 80% no tempo de triagem de currículos.
    • Zero retrabalho em contratos padronizados.
    • Maior segurança na análise de documentos.
    • Escalabilidade: sistema pronto para lidar com centenas de candidatos simultaneamente.

    🚀 Conclusão

    Este case demonstra que a combinação de n8n + IA vai muito além da automação simples: ela cria ecossistemas inteligentes capazes de substituir horas de trabalho repetitivo por fluxos auditáveis e escaláveis.

    No RH, isso significa mais tempo para focar em talentos.

    Na empresa como um todo, abre portas para automatizações horizontais em qualquer setor.

    O futuro já chegou e é low-code + IA.

    Compartilhe
    Comentários (2)
    Lucas Ramos
    Lucas Ramos - 10/09/2025 10:21

    Intuito é melhorar o agente, onde conseguimos de acordo com o que cliente precisar. Esse agente 1.0 é apenas uma base do poder que ele trm. O que ele pode fazer vai muito mais além. Sobre projetos para outro setores, já temos agentes para almoxarifado. Temos idéias para atender setor financeiro, medição, técnica... nosso foco consguir autotizar no mínimo 80% do serviço burocrático dentro das empresas.

    DIO Community
    DIO Community - 10/09/2025 10:08

    Lucas, que projeto incrível! O seu artigo mostra de forma prática como a automação low-code combinada com IA generativa pode transformar processos tradicionais de RH, indo muito além da simples redução de tarefas repetitivas. Gostei especialmente de como você detalhou cada agente conectando a tecnologia à eficiência real e à segurança dos dados.

    Na DIO, valorizamos muito esse espírito de aplicar tecnologia para resolver problemas complexos, mas de maneira escalável e auditável. O trecho em que você comenta que o sistema libera tempo para que o RH foque em talentos exemplifica perfeitamente o impacto estratégico da automação inteligente.

    Me conta: olhando para frente, você pretende expandir esse ecossistema para outros setores da empresa ou aperfeiçoar ainda mais a análise multimodal de documentos com IA para torná-la mais robusta e confiável?